Shop Soko

SOKO is a jewellery brand founded to connect artisans in Kenya with the global market through technology and ethical production. Its collections include earrings, rings, necklaces, and cuffs crafted from recycled brass, reclaimed horn, and locally sourced materials. Working with artisan communities, SOKO empowers makers with fair pay and sustainable employment. The designs are bold yet wearable, blending modern aesthetics with African heritage. What makes SOKO unique is its fusion of social impact and contemporary design, redefining how jewellery can serve both people and planet. With an identity rooted in responsibility and empowerment, SOKO appeals to those who want fair-trade jewelry that is stylish and meaningful, positioning itself as a pioneer in ethical fashion.

Nikita By Niki
Jewelry Brands

Nikita by Niki is a UK-based jewellery and lifestyle brand founded by designer Niki Mahon. It offers a wide range of jewellery, including statement necklaces, earrings, and bracelets, crafted in gold plating, silver, and stainless steel. The brand is known for bold yet accessible designs that celebrate individuality and self-expression, often with chunky chains, crystal embellishments, or layered styling. Beyond jewellery, Nikita by Niki also extends into homeware and fashion accessories, reinforcing its lifestyle ethos. What makes the brand stand out is its ability to merge trend-led designs with affordability, creating pieces that are both striking and wearable. With a confident and youthful identity, Nikita by Niki appeals to customers looking for affordable jewelry that makes a statement, positioning itself as a vibrant name in the UK’s fashion jewellery scene.

Emilie Bliguet Ethical Jewellery
Jewelry Brands

Emilie Bliguet Ethical Jewellery is a Swiss brand founded by designer Emilie Bliguet, who wanted to create jewelry that is beautiful while respecting both people and the planet. Based in Lausanne, the brand focuses on clean, modern designs that carry a timeless appeal, crafted using only recycled gold and responsibly sourced gemstones. Every piece is made locally by skilled artisans, ensuring small scale production and high attention to detail. Emilie’s style is minimal yet refined, with collections that include delicate rings, earrings, and necklaces suited for both everyday wear and special occasions. The brand is certified by the Responsible Jewellery Council, reflecting its strong commitment to transparency and ethical standards. Customers choose Emilie Bliguet Ethical Jewellery for pieces that are elegant, responsibly made, and designed to last. It has become a trusted choice for those who want ethical jewelry that combines modern aesthetics with honest craftsmanship.

Dear Rae
Jewelry Brands

Dear Rae is a South African jewellery brand founded in Cape Town, known for creating timeless pieces inspired by simplicity and authenticity. Its collections include rings, earrings, bracelets, and necklaces hand-crafted in sterling silver and gold, often featuring subtle gemstones. The brand is built around the philosophy of conscious production, using responsibly sourced materials and maintaining transparency in its process. What sets Dear Rae apart is its dedication to slow design pieces made to be lived in, loved, and passed down. The identity is warm, sincere, and natural, reflecting the South African landscape and lifestyle. Dear Rae appeals to customers who want sustainable jewelry that is understated yet meaningful, securing its place as one of South Africa’s most loved independent jewellery labels.
